State of the Industry: Buying and Selling Online Advertising The online media world has fragmented, growing from a handful of properties to countless online destinations in a short time creating an advertising environment that is tougher for everyone. Publishers have to fight harder for their share of advertising dollars, while advertisers and agencies lack a simple, scalable way to reach targeted audiences. Ad networks struggle to maintain profit margins with ineffective monetization and challenges with differentiation. In order to chase down their audiences, agencies and advertisers spread their dollars across a wider array of properties, forcing publishers to manually consolidate enough high-quality inventory for large advertising demands. Additionally, publishers face increasing competition from ad networks who, in addition to grabbing a share of ad spend, have placed downward pricing pressure on ad inventory. 1
2 These market dynamics have forced publishers to waste too much effort on inefficient, manual operations. They manage multiple advertisers and multiple ad networks, armed with manual processes and spreadsheets. Sales forces spend a disproportionate amount of time trying to close deals on lower-value inventory, and then spend the balance of their time taking care of those advertisers. These inefficiencies spread throughout the organization, requiring resources from other groups as well. A fragmented market has created an advertising environment that is tougher for everyone. Publishers also face technology limitations, as they use outdated legacy ad management systems that were not built to handle the complexity of today s marketplace. The result is that publisher inventory is not realizing its full value, and money is being left on the table in the form of unsold or undersold advertising inventory. In this same environment, agencies and advertisers struggle to reach consumers who as a consequence of the proliferation of both media and platforms are even harder to engage. Advertisers and agencies are burdened with the time-consuming task of finding the high-quality inventory they need, and buying media from multiple publishers to get their required reach and relevance. Advertisers have a difficult time finding ad serving technology that provides them with the ability to deliver targeted communications to customers demographically, geographically, and behaviorally. Additionally, they often need to devote resources to play watchdog to their brand, carefully screening advertising opportunities to ensure their brand is being displayed in the contexts they desire. The business of online advertising is evolving As the media world evolved, the business of online advertising has followed suit in order to remain an effective means of communicating with consumers. In just a few short years, the industry has seen the rise and proliferation of ad networks, as service providers and aggregated supply sources. On an almost parallel path emerged the ad exchange, an auction-based marketplace between buyer and seller. 2
3 Ad networks make the business of advertising easier on advertisers and agencies by aggregating supply and demand, managing the buying and selling of media. This structure results in pricing models determined by the network, who make a profit re-selling inventory. Each network is its own closed ecosystem, so buyers and sellers are limited in supply by the networks they join. If they joined multiple networks, they have to manage multiple infrastructures. The ad exchange enables more relationships by creating an effective auction marketplace, providing agencies, advertisers, publishers and networks a direct line to buy and sell on their own.
